Abstract

The utility model relates to the field of a construction technology, in particular to a lateral inclined strut device for a wall/column template, which is used for bearing a lateral load and ensuring the verticality of a vertical supporting template. The lateral inclined strut device is characterized by comprising a steel pipe inclined strut I, a steel pipe inclined strut II, a double-ended stud, a base and a top support. The both ends of the double-ended stud are respectively in threaded connection with one end of the steel pipe inclined strut I and one end of the steel pipe inclined strut II; the other end of the steel pipe inclined strut I is hinged with the base; the other end of the steel pipe inclined strut II is hinged with the top support; and the thread directions at the both ends of the double-ended stud are opposite. A rotary rod is arranged at the middle part of the double-ended stud. Compared with the prior art, the lateral inclined strut device provided by the utility model has the advantages as follows: the lateral inclined strut device can be used for bearing the lateral load of the wall, the column and the like, and regulating the verticality of the vertical supporting template, so that the structural size of the wall, the column and the like can be further ensured; the lateral inclined strut device has the advantages of simple structure, convenience in use, and low cost; and the structural size of the wall/column can be effectively ensured, so that the working efficiency of the construction is further improved.

Background technology
In building operations, wall, post are important force structure, so how to guarantee that the design size of wall, rod structure is particularly important, particularly lateral load and verticality are difficult to control in construction, in concrete pouring construction, are easy to the mould phenomenon that rises.Traditional job practices is: the side direction template that at first will install horizontal vertical steel pipe keel is proofreaied and correct according to design size; Adopt the cast iron buckle that side direction steel pipe diagonal brace one end is connected with the steel pipe keel then, the steel pipe diagonal brace other end is fixed on the solid ground.In the concreting process, along with amount of concrete continues to increase, lateral load is also increasing, and the conduction pattern of power is: lateral pressure → template → steel pipe keel → cast iron buckle → steel pipe diagonal brace → ground.Owing to just can carry out next procedure behind the adjustment template size earlier, so increased operation, reduced operating efficiency, increased engineering cost.And the conduction of power mainly leans on the frictional force between cast iron buckle and the steel pipe, in case adopt underproof buckle, will be difficult to ensure the quality of products, and buckle loss in use is very big, has increased material cost.

The specific embodiment
Describe in further detail below in conjunction with the specific embodiment of accompanying drawing the utility model.
See Fig. 1; Be the utility model wall, column template lateral diagonal device example structure sketch map; Comprise steel pipe diagonal brace 1, steel pipe diagonal brace 22, studs 3, base 4 and shore 5, the two ends of studs 3 respectively with an end of steel pipe diagonal brace 1 and steel pipe diagonal brace 22 on nut 6 be threaded, the other end of steel pipe diagonal brace 1 is hinged through pin 1 and base 4; The other end of steel pipe diagonal brace 22 through pin 28 with shore 5 hingedly, the two ends hand of spiral of studs 3 is opposite.
The middle part of studs 3 is provided with swing arm 9, and turn swing arm 9 can make the distance between steel pipe diagonal brace 1 and the steel pipe diagonal brace 22 increase fast or reduce, and realizes the length adjustment of the utility model bracing device.
The method for using of this device is: shoring of this device 5 withstood on the steel pipe keel, and base 4 is fixed on the ground, utilizes swing arm 9 rotation adjustment length; Make shore 5 with base 4 stretchings; The project organization size that finally transfers to wall, post formwork erection gets final product, and this structural adjustment is reliable, and is easy to use; Stop the generation of " mould rises ", can improve efficiency of construction effectively.
